    Dhafir Harris (born August 4, 1977) known as Dada 5000, is a Bahamian-American retired mixed martial artist. He is a former internet celebrity known for no holds barred street fight videos. He was the subject of the 2015 documentary film Dawg Fight. His most notable MMA fight was against the late Kimbo Slice at Bellator 149.

Oct 24, 2022 · Dhafir "Dada 5000" Harris, who suffered cardiac arrest and kidney failure in his last fight in 2016, was not allowed to compete in Tampa, Fla., due to his indefinite suspension in Texas. The Florida commission said it will not lift his suspension until the Texas commission does so.

  4. Apr 13, 2016 · Dhafir Harris, also known as Dada 5000, suffered cardiac arrest, renal failure and two heart attacks after losing to Kimbo Slice in February 2016. He said he was pronounced dead and saw the light before being revived by doctors.
